红松天然林生长变异及早期选择的研究

摘    要:目的]探究红松早期选择的适宜年龄.方法]对小兴安岭5个种源25株红松天然林个体进行了调查.结果]红松天然林个体的生长变异随年龄增大而减小,40年是个体生长从激烈分化转为相对平稳的转折年龄.根据变异系数、相关系数和选择效率3个指标的分析,初步确定红松天然林早期选择的最佳年龄40年.可用40年的树高和胸径平方预估150年的材积.结论]为红松选择优树、确定遗传改良试验鉴定年龄等育种手段提供了理论依据.

Growth Variation and Early Selection of Nature Korean Pine Forest

Abstract: Objective ] The aim was to explore the optimal age for early selection of Pinus koraiensis. Method ] 25 individual trees from 5 provenances of P. koraiensis in Xiaoxinganling area were studied. Result ] The growth variation of individual Korean pine trees decreased with the increase of age. Forty years was the turning point of individual growth from the competitive differentiation to the steady growth. Based on the analyses of three indicators variation coefficient, relative coefficient and selection efficiency, the optimal age for the early selection of natural Korean pine forest was 40 years. Thus the height and diameter' square of 40 years may be used to predict the volume of 150 years. Conclusion] The results provide theoretical basis for selection of plus tree of natural Korean pine forest and determining identified age of Genetic improvement test.
